Homes Near Utah’s Famous National Monuments

Utah is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es, which include a diverse array of stunning national monuments. These monuments, offering incredible outdoor experiences and scenic views, attract nature lovers, adventurers, and families alike. If you're considering moving to Utah or simply looking for a vacation home, you might want to explore properties near these iconic sites.

One of the most notable national monuments in Utah is Arches National Park. Located in Moab, this park is famous for its natural sandstone arches and unique rock formations. Homes near Arches provide residents with easy access to hiking, rock climbing, and mountain biking. The vibrant town of Moab offers a range of real estate options, from cozy cabins to modern homes, making it ideal for those wanting to immerse themselves in nature.

Another gem, Capitol Reef National Park, features stunning canyons, cliffs, and unique rock formations. Properties close to this monument offer picturesque views and the tranquility of rural living. Torrey, a charming small town near Capitol Reef, boasts several homes that cater to those looking for a quiet lifestyle surrounded by breathtaking landscapes. The area is perfect for stargazing, given its low light pollution and vast open skies.

Monument Valley is a striking symbol of the American West, characterized by its iconic buttes and mesas. The nearby town of Kayenta provides various housing options for those looking to experience the dramatic beauty of this area and immerse themselves in Navajo culture. Living near Monument Valley allows residents to enjoy outdoor adventures and rich cultural experiences, including Navajo crafts, traditions, and cuisine.

If you’re drawn to the rugged beauty of the Grand Staircase-Escalante National Monument, consider homes in nearby Escalante or Boulder. Known for its stunning geological formations and diverse ecosystems, this monument is a paradise for hikers and nature enthusiasts. Properties in this area often offer privacy, spacious lots, and pristine views, making it an ideal choice for those seeking a peaceful retreat.

Lastly, Natural Bridges National Monument is another notable site that showcases magnificent natural bridges carved by water over thousands of years. Homes in the nearby town of Blanding give residents access to both the natural beauty of the monument and the amenities of a small town. This area is perfect for outdoor lovers looking to explore the many hiking trails and canyoneering opportunities.

Buying a home near Utah’s national monuments not only offers a unique lifestyle but also serves as a gateway to outdoor adventures, cultural experiences, and the beauty of nature. Whether you're seeking a primary residence or a vacation getaway, the areas surrounding these monuments provide various options to suit your needs and preferences.
